Director of Development: City Academy of Atlanta
Job Description: The
Director of Development
is responsible for leading all fundraising, donor relations, and strategic development initiatives. This role is critical to the long-term sustainability and growth of City Academy of Atlanta and supports scholarships, operations, capital improvements, and program expansion.
Key responsibilities of the
Director of Development
include but are not limited to:
Fundraising & Revenue Generation
Develop and execute a comprehensive annual development strategy aligned with CAA’s mission and growth goals
Cultivate and solicit individual, major, corporate, and foundation donors
Lead all grant research, writing, submission, and reporting
Plan and manage fundraising campaigns and events
Build and maintain a donor pipeline and long-term stewardship strategy
Donor Relations & Stewardship
Strengthen relationships with donors, families, alumni, and community partners
Design communication strategies including donor updates, appeals, recognition, and impact reporting
Manage donor database and acknowledgment systems
Strategic Planning & School Collaboration
Partner with school leadership to align fundraising with operational priorities
Forecast financial development opportunities
Represent CAA at community and outreach events
Communications & Marketing Support
Assist with mission-driven messaging across fundraising, website, and reporting materials
Ensure transparency and accountability in donor communications
Leadership & Team Management
Lead and mentor development staff, volunteers, or committees
Report regularly on fundraising results and progress to the City Academy Board
Model Christ-centered professionalism and integrity
Position Qualifications: Required Qualifications
5+ years of fundraising or development leadership experience
Proven success in donor engagement and revenue growth
Strong communication and grant writing skills
Experience in education, nonprofit, or faith-based organizations preferred
Deep personal alignment with Christian education and CAA’s mission
Desired Attributes
Passion for supporting families and Christian education
Collaborative leadership style
High integrity and professionalism

Description of Organization Who We Are
City Academy of Atlanta is a Christ-centered hybrid homeschool community serving families in the Atlanta area. Our mission is to glorify God by educating children to think, believe, and live biblically. We partner with parents to provide an academically rich education rooted in a biblical worldview while cultivating wisdom, character, and faith in every student.
What We Do
City Academy blends on-campus learning with guided home instruction through a unique hybrid model. Students attend classes on campus several days each week and continue their learning at home using lesson plans and support from our teachers. Our curriculum integrates faith and learning across all subjects while encouraging curiosity, critical thinking, and joyful discovery.
